Definition of Online Community

  • An online community is a virtual space where individuals connect, share information, and support one another, usually driven by common interests or goals.
  • In Forex trading, online communities allow traders to share strategies, insights, and success stories as they navigate the complexities of the market together.

  • The Role of Communication in Online Communities

  • Effective communication helps foster relationships and builds trust among community members, which is essential for a vibrant trading community.
  • Platforms like Discord and Telegram facilitate real-time interactions, enabling traders to ask questions, share tips, and encourage one another. 💬
  • Contributions and Sharing Knowledge

  • Members of online communities are encouraged to share their trading experiences, strategies, and results, which adds valuable content for others to learn from.
  • By showcasing successes and failures, traders can build a culture of transparency and learning, helping others to avoid pitfalls and embrace effective strategies. 📈
  • Support Systems Within Online Communities

  • Online trading communities often provide support channels for traders facing challenges, allowing them to seek advice and solutions in a non-judgmental space.
  • These platforms help reduce the isolation many traders feel by connecting them with like-minded individuals who share their struggles and victories. 🌍
